Bingsu
Bingsu is a popular Korean shaved ice dessert that has gained worldwide recognition. This refreshing treat typically consists of finely shaved ice topped with various ingredients such as sweetened condensed milk, fruit, red bean paste, and even ice cream.
With endless variations like mango bingsu or matcha bingsu, it’s a perfect dessert to share during hot summer days or any festive occasion.
Hotteok
Hotteok is a beloved Korean street food that makes for a delightful dessert. These sweet, fluffy pancakes are filled with brown sugar, cinnamon, and chopped nuts, creating a gooey center that melts in your mouth.
Whether enjoyed at a market stall or made at home, hotteok is best shared warm, making it a perfect choice for family gatherings or cozy evenings with friends.

Patbingsu
Patbingsu is similar to bingsu but focuses primarily on red bean, which is a staple in many Korean desserts. Topped with shaved ice, sweetened red beans, and often accompanied by barley or fruit, this dessert is both satisfying and delicious.
Patbingsu is an excellent choice for those who enjoy the combination of textures and flavors, making it a delightful treat to enjoy with family.
Korean Cream Cheese Garlic Bread
This trendy dessert features a bread roll filled with a rich, sweet cream cheese filling and topped with a savory garlic butter mixture. The combination might sound unusual, but the balance of sweet and savory makes it incredibly delicious.
Perfect for sharing, Korean cream cheese garlic bread is a hit at gatherings and can even serve as a dessert after a hearty meal.

Injeolmi
This traditional Korean rice cake is made from glutinous rice flour and coated with powdered soybean flour. Its chewy texture and nutty flavor make it a fantastic dessert option, perfect for sharing on special occasions.
Injeolmi is often enjoyed with tea, making it a lovely addition to any gathering with family and friends.
